Latest Patents

Eynon's most recent patent is titled "Cowl assembly with snap-on seals." This invention pertains to a vehicle body ventilation system designed for vehicles equipped with a windshield, a hood, and a cowl assembly. The cowl assembly features a cowl grille panel with a front and rear edge, incorporating a first seal that includes a sealing portion and a carrier portion. The carrier portion is frictionally engaged with the front edge of the cowl grille panel. Additionally, a second seal is provided, which also includes a sealing portion and a carrier portion, with the carrier portion engaged with the rear edge of the cowl grille panel. The design ensures that the sealing portions of both seals effectively seal to the vehicle's windshield and hood, enhancing the overall performance of the vehicle.
